No Fasting Before Thanksgiving Dinner!
Employing a plan to avoid eating too many unhealthy foods on Thanksgiving is a good idea, but there’s one strategy that’s actually a recipe for failure: fasting before the big meal. Total deprivation actually leads to extreme hunger, cravings, and, inevitably, overeating at mealtime — everything that the South Beach Diet principles work to prevent. Fortunately, there are alternative tactics you can use to avoid overeating on Thanksgiving and throughout the year.
- Eat healthfully throughout the day.
- Engage in physical activity.
- Enlist help.
- Bring snacks along to parties.
- Allow yourself a few indulgences.
